Purchasing Power Analysis

A Engineers, All Other in Hauppauge, NE earns $80,725 in nominal terms, which is 6.8% above the national average of $75,564. After adjusting for the local cost of living (index 90.8 vs national 100), this is equivalent to $88,904 in national-average purchasing power.

Tax differences are not included. Only cost-of-living index adjustments are applied.
